Soaring seagulls. Sprawling landscapes. Dashing sea captains.
They’re all on display at the Coupeville Elementary School Art Show, which runs from May 25-June 7.
Working with a grant from the Community Foundation for Coupeville Public Schools, CES Art/Music Specialist Kim McWilliams spent the past three months working with her students to produce a wide range of art works.
Featuring Penn Cove, Ebey’s Landing, Deception Pass, the Greenbank Farm and enough seagulls to remind older viewers of Alfred Hitchcock’s “The Birds,” the artwork is currently filling the hallways at CES.
If you’re interested in viewing Cow Town’s next Monet’s, stop by the school (6 S. Main) any time during normal school hours (9 AM-3:30 PM) and check in at the office.
